What is the first step in determining relative extrema using the second derivative test?
Graph the function to find extrema.
Evaluate the function at various points.
Determine the critical numbers where the first derivative is zero or undefined.
Find the second derivative of the function.
2.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
How do you find the critical numbers of a function?
By setting the second derivative equal to zero.
By finding where the first derivative is zero or undefined.
By evaluating the function at x = 0.
By graphing the function.
3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What does a positive second derivative at a critical number indicate?
The function has a point of inflection.
The function is concave up, indicating a relative minimum.
The function is concave down, indicating a relative maximum.
The function is undefined at that point.
